Binder-Ready Trading Card Sleeves: Fit & Function

Securing your valuable stash of trading cards requires more than just any protective sleeve; binder-ready sleeves offer a specialized design engineered for seamless integration with three-ring binders. The key is the precisely measured dimensions – typically 91mm x 67mm – which ensures a snug, yet not overly tight, fit within standard binder pockets. This prevents damage from bending or tearing, a common issue with incorrectly sized sleeves. Furthermore, many binder-ready sleeves are constructed click here from crystal-clear, archival-safe plastic, protecting against UV light and preserving the card’s condition for years to come. Choosing the right thickness – usually ranging from 1-3 mil – also impacts both the level of protection and the overall feel within the binder. Thicker sleeves offer increased rigidity and safeguarding, while thinner options allow for a more comfortable browsing experience.
